Affectionately known as Dr G, Tshidi Gule is a qualified medical doctor, health advocate, employee health expert, celebrated author, medical health personality, and entrepreneur who can now add host of a web series to her repertoire.
From Saturday, 19 September – and for six consecutive weeks thereafter – Dr G will be hosting The Wellness Diaries with Dr G. Crafted by and for women, each one and a half hour virtual webisodes will see the good doctor delve deep into topics such as fatigue, depression, weight loss, sexual health and more.

The first webisode in the series, titled Why Am I Tired?, will shed much-needed light on tiredness and fatigue which are currently placed in the top 10 most Googled symptoms across the world. And it’s no surprise why. “COVID-19 may have tipped the scales of tiredness for millions of people adjusting to a new way of working and living. With a reported 40% increase in mental health episodes, this symptom is showing up in almost every medical consultation,” says Dr G.
The key issues that will be addressed in the episode include:
- Are you really tired? – Defining the word.
- Energynomics – Understand how the body manages energy.
- The 10 most common reasons why you are tired.
- The thyroid, adrenal glands, and brain physiology of fatigue.
- Medical treatments for fatigue.
- Recovery – How to manage your journey back to normality.
